Gem Member Of Parliament, Elisha Odhiambo is accusing the Siaya County Governor James Orengo of failing to help the county’s public hospitals procure drugs and essential medical equipment. Odhiambo faulted governor James Orengo for allegedly failing to honor his pre-election pledges to improve health services which he says was exposing patients. Details of this and more in our County News Roundup. The legislator was speaking at Gongo primary school grounds in Central Gem location during a public baraza. He faulted the Siaya county leadership for the deteriorating state of health in Siaya County. He also lobbied to the chair of the budget committee in parliament, to ensure Siaya County get its fair share of funding to improve service delivery.
